3# GENERIC32_IP12 machine description file
4# 
5# This machine description file is used to generate the default NetBSD
6# kernel.  The generic kernel does not include all options, subsystems
7# and device drivers, but should be useful for most applications.
8#
9# The machine description file can be customised for your specific
10# machine to reduce the kernel size and improve its performance.
11#
12# For further information on compiling NetBSD kernels, see the config(8)
13# man page.
14#
15# For further information on hardware support for this architecture, see
16# the intro(4) man page.  For further information about kernel options
17# for this architecture, see the options(4) man page.  For an explanation
18# of each device driver in this file see the section 4 man page for the
19# device.
20#
21#
22# Currently this config file supports Personal IRIS 4D/2x (IP6/IP10),
23# Personal IRIS 4D/3x (IP12) and Indigo R3k (IP12).
24#
25# Note that to load at beginning of memory, the kernel _must_ be under
26# 3.5MB in size to avoid stomping on (or being stomped on by) the PROM.
27#

206# Common devices
207int0		at mainbus0			# Interrupt controller
208scsibus*	at scsi?			# HPC or IOC SCSI
209
210# IP6/10 devices
211ctl0		at mainbus0 addr 0x1f800000	# Memory controller
212oioc0		at mainbus0 addr 0x1f900000	# 'Old' I/O Controller
213dpclock0	at mainbus0 addr 0x1fbc0000	# RTC
214scn0		at mainbus0 addr 0x1fb80004	# Signetics 2681 Serial Port
215oiocsc* 	at oioc? offset ?		# On-board WD33C93 SCSI
216le*		at oioc? offset ?		# AMD LANCE AM7990 Ethernet
217
218# Personal Iris / Indigo R3k devices
219pic0		at mainbus0 addr 0x1fa00000	# Memory Controller
220gio0		at pic0				# GIO32 bus
221dpclock0	at mainbus0 addr 0x1fb80e00	# RTC
222hpc0 		at gio? addr 0x1fb80000		# High-perf. Peripheral. Ctrlers
223hpc1 		at gio? addr 0x1fb00000
224hpc2 		at gio? addr 0x1f980000
225grtwo*		at gio?				# Express (GR2) graphics
226wsdisplay*	at grtwo? console ?
227light*		at gio?			# Light/Starter/Entry (LG1/LG2) graphics
228wsdisplay*	at light? console ?
229sq* 		at hpc? offset ?	# On-board ethernet / E++ adapter
230wdsc* 		at hpc? offset ?	# On-board SCSI / GIO32 SCSI adapter
231wskbd*		at zskbd? console ?
232wsmouse*	at zsms? mux 0
233zsc0 		at hpc0 offset ?
234zstty*		at zsc0 channel ?
235zsc1 		at hpc0 offset ?	# IP12 keyboard/mouse
236zskbd0		at zsc1 channel 0
237zsms0		at zsc1 channel 1
